Accounting practice in the United States follows the generally accepted accounting principles (GAAP) developed by the Financial Accounting Standards Board (FASB), which is a nongovernmental, professional standards body that monitors accounting practices and evaluates controversial issues. The Securities and Exchange Commission (SEC) requires all publicly traded companies to periodically report their financial information.
A publicly held corporation must publish an annual report that contains the balance sheet, income statement, statement of cash flows, statement of retained earnings, and other financial information for analysis.
The following descriptions of the major financial statements and reports that a firm publishes. Identify the correct statement or report for each description.
Description :
a. Is required by the SEC and includes the audited document that shows the company's financial results for the past year and management's discussion about the future outlook and plans
b. Gives details about the firm's sales, costs, and profits for the past accounting period
c. Details changes in the capital received from investors in exchange for stock (paid-in capital), donated capital, and retained earings.
d. Provides details about the flow of funds from operating, investing, and financing activities.
e. Summarizes a company's assets, liabilities, and stockholders' equity at a specific point in time.
Answer: a. Annual Report
b. Income statement
c. Statement of Shareholder Equity.
d. Cashflow Statement
e. Balance Sheet.
Explanation:
The Annual Report is a comprehensive report that aims to show stakeholders including the SEC what the company has been up to in the previous year. It analyzes the business's financial report and also the strategic goals of the business as well.
The Income Statement lets stakeholders know how the company's business transactions went for the previous period. It shows how much goods and services were sold as well as the expenses involved.
The Statement of Shareholder Equity aims to show how the business's dealings during the year have impacted the ownership of the company. It shows the Capital and the Retained Earnings.
The Cashflow Statement aims to show just how much actual cash that the business has. To do so it usually divides the cash transactions into Operating, Investing, and Financing activities.
The Balance Sheet summarizes the components of the Accounting Equation which includes Assets, Liabilities and Equity. This way a person can see at a glance how the business operates.

Oscar owns a building that is destroyed in a hurricane. His adjusted basis in the building before the hurricane is $130,000. His insurance company pays him $140,000 and he immediately invests in a new building at a cost of $142,000. What is Oscar's basis on his new building?
Answer: $132,000
Explanation:
Oscar's new basis on the building will be the basis of the old building plus any additional investment he added.
This is the because there is no gain on the $140,000 he received because it was an Involuntary Conversion amount and he reinvested it into another building within a period of 2 years.
As there is no gain, the building will retain it's original basis but will add any amount outside the involuntary replacement cost of the building.
The Additional basis will be,
= Cost of building - Insurance
= 142,000 - 140,000
= $2,000
The Basis for the new building is,
= 130,000 + 2,000
= $132,000
Biarritz Corp. is growing quickly. Dividends are expected to grow at a rate of 29 percent for the next three years, with the growth rate falling off to a constant 6.8 percent thereafter. If the required return is 15 percent and the company just paid a dividend of $3.15, what is the current share price
Answer:
The current price of the share is $69.85
Explanation:
To calculate the current share price, we will use the dividend discount model approach.
The dividend discount model (DDM) estimates the value of a share/stock based on the present value of the expected future dividends from the stock. We will use the two stage growth model of DDM here as the growth in dividends of the stock is divided into two stages.
The formula for current price under two stage growth model is,
P0 = D0 * (1+g1) / (1+r) + D0 * (1+g1)^2 / (1+r)^2 + ... + D0 * (1+g1)^n / (1+r)^n +
[( D0 * (1+g1)^n * (1+g2)) / (r - g2)] / (1+r)^n
Where,
g1 is initial growth rateg2 is the constant growth rater is the required rate of returnSo, the price of the stock today will be,
P0 = 3.15 * (1+0.29) / (1+0.15) + 3.15 * (1+0.29)^2 / (1+0.15)^2 +
3.15 * (1+0.29)^3 / (1+0.15)^3 +
[( 3.15 * (1+0.29)^3 * (1+0.068)) / (0.15 - 0.068)] / (1+0.15)^3
P0 = $69.85196 rounded off to $69.85

Outstanding stock of the Blue Corporation included 50000 shares of $5 par common stock and 18000 shares of 5%, $10 par non-cumulative preferred stock. In 2019, Blue declared and paid dividends of $7500. In 2020, Blue declared and paid dividends of $25000. How much of the 2020 dividend was distributed to preferred shareholders
Answer:
The dividends to be distributed among preferred stockholders in 2020 is $9000
Explanation:
The preferred stock holders are always paid dividends before the common stock holders. The amount left after paying preferred stockholders is paid to common stockholders as dividends.
Non cumulative preferred stock does not accrue or accumulates dividends. Thus, if dividends are not paid in a particular year, the company has no obligation to pay these dividends ever in the future.
Preferred stock dividend per year = 18000 * 10 * 0.05
Preferred stock dividend per year = $9000
As the preferred stock is non cumulative, then the remaining dividends for 2019 (which are 9000 - 7500 = $1500) will not be paid in 2020.
So, the preferred stock dividends to be paid in 2020 will be $9000 as the declared dividends are more than that required to pay the preferred stockholders.

The following monthly data are available for Sheridan Company which produces only one product: Selling price per unit, $38; Unit variable expenses, $14; Total fixed expenses, $42000; Actual sales for the month of June, 7000 units. How much is the margin of safety for the company for June
Answer:
$199,500
Explanation:
The computation of the margin of safety is shown below:
As we know that
margin of safety = Actual sales - break even sales
where,
Actual sales is
= Actual sales units × Selling price per unit
= 7,000 units × $38
= $266,000
And, the break even sales is
= Fixed cost ÷ contribution margin per unit
= $42,000 ÷ ($38 - $14)
= $42,000 ÷ $24
= 1,750 units
Now the break even sales is
= Break even units × selling price per unit
= 1,750 units × $38
= $66,500
So, the margin of safety is
= $266,000 - $66,500
= $199,500

The Securities and Exchange Commission and the Federal Aviation Administration are examples of agencies engaged in A. the regulation of nonmonopolistic industries. B. health and safety regulation. C. social regulation. D. the regulation of natural monopolies.
Answer:
A. the regulation of nonmonopolistic industries.
Explanation:
The Securities and Exchange Commission and the Federal Aviation Administration are examples of agencies engaged in the regulation of nonmonopolistic industries.
A nonmonopolistic industry is one that is characterized by competition among various service providers in a country and generally there's a government agency that regulates their actions and activities in the public.
The Securities and Exchange Commission (SEC) is a governmental agency saddled with the sole responsibility of regulating the securities or capital markets, as well as protecting investors in a country.
In the U.S, the Securities and Exchange Commission (SEC) as an independent government agency was established under the Securities Act of 1933 and the Securities and Exchange Act of 1934 of the United States of America.
Hence, SEC has the power to propose securities rules and regulations, and enforce federal securities law in the securities market.
The Federal Aviation Administration (FAA) was founded on the 23rd of August, 1958 under the Federal Aviation Act of 1958 of the United States of America. It is an independent government agency with the responsibility of regulating civil aviation, commercial space transportation, construction and maintenance of airports, air traffic management and operations of navigation systems for both civil and military aircrafts, and issuance of licenses to airline operators with their personnel.
